Output 934ced633770263f3dc7f558de1daaa0f8dd34ad8cd3cc97367be351e0fc493b:3

value
27516867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042682b7abe62d15b95cc4f4a57a8cce6ec615e9 OP_EQUAL
address
M8H74xkGuNCEktvYjWW2Tr1DYJ3b2YgEJe
transaction
934ced633770263f3dc7f558de1daaa0f8dd34ad8cd3cc97367be351e0fc493b
spent
false